Master of Education (M.Ed.) at Madan-Aashrit Smriti Multiple Campus, Kerkha, Jhapa
The Master of Education (M.Ed.) at Madan-Aashrit Smriti Multiple Campus is a two-year postgraduate program conducted at Kamal Rural Municipality-3, Kerkha, Jhapa, Koshi Province. The program is affiliated with Purbanchal University and has been offered at the campus since 2069 BS.
The campus has 180 seats for M.Ed. and offers Nepali, English, Health, and EPM (Educational Planning and Management) as specialization areas. The program combines advanced study in education with specialization, research-related coursework, practicum, and thesis work. Classes use multimedia systems, and students have access to the campus library and other academic resources.

Eligibility
Eligibility: Applicants with a B.Ed. degree of one year, two years, or three years from Purbanchal University or from a university recognized by Purbanchal University are eligible to apply for admission to the M.Ed. program.
Specialization study is connected with the student's academic background in the relevant subject area.

Academic Structure
The M.Ed. curriculum combines core education courses with specialization and research-oriented academic work.
Major academic areas within the program include:
-
Foundations of Education
-
Educational Psychology
-
Curriculum Planning and Practices
-
Measurement and Evaluation in Education
-
Research Methodology
-
Specialization courses
-
Practicum
-
Thesis
The practicum and thesis are connected with the student's chosen specialization area.

Internal Evaluation
Internal Evaluation: 20 percent
The M.Ed. program at the campus includes 20 percent internal evaluation as part of its academic assessment.
The university grading system for M.Ed. includes the following divisions:
-
Third Division: 40 percent and above
-
Second Division: 50 percent and above
-
First Division: 60 percent and above
-
Distinction: 75 percent and above

Library and Academic Resources
M.Ed. students have access to the campus library and other shared learning resources.
The campus has:
-
6,631 books
-
21 computers and laptops
-
6 projectors
-
1 computer lab
-
3 printers
-
6 book racks
The library serves the different academic levels and programs conducted by the campus. Computer and multimedia resources support classroom instruction, research-related work, presentations, and other academic activities.
